Apple Cake

- 2 1/2 Cups flour shopping list
- 1 Cup Granulated sugar (+ an extra few tbsp, reserved for apples) shopping list
- 1 tsp baking powder shopping list
- 3/4 tsp Salt* shopping list
- 1/2 tsp cinnamon (+ an extra tsp, reserved for the apples) shopping list
- 2/3 Cup canola oil, or 2/3 Cup Earth Balance margarine, softened shopping list
- 2/3 Cup non- dairy milk + 2 tsp apple cider vinegar (or lemon juice) shopping list
- 2 Tbs cornstarch mixed with 1/2 Cup water shopping list
- 2 tsp vanilla extract shopping list
- 4-5 medium apples, peeled cored and cut in chunks shopping list
- 1 Tbs sugar mixed with 1 tsp cinnamon, for topping shopping list
- *Reduce salt to 1/2 tsp if using Earth Balance. shopping list
How to make it
- Preheat oven to 350º F.
- Combine all the dry ingredients of the cake and mix well. Add all of the liquid ingredients and fold the batter until just combined. The batter should be thick and nearly dough-like, as this will prevent the apples from sinking to the bottom of the pan.
- Spread 1/2 of the batter in the bottom of a 9×11″ (or whatever) greased baking dish.
- Mix apples with reserved cinnamon sugar. Add them evenly over the top of the batter.
- Spoon the rest of the batter over the apples in clumps, leaving some of the apples showing through.
- Sprinkle with extra cinnamon sugar mixture.
- Bake for 80 to 90 minutes or until a tester comes out clean.(***THIS COOKING TIME NOT VERIFIED***) Be sure not to under bake. You may wish to cover the cake with aluminum foil for the last 20-30 minutes to prevent over-browning.
- Remove cake from oven and let cool before serving.
